ON DEMAND: Protect and Secure Your Hard-Earned Money: Preparing For Your Financial Future and Identifying Scams
You’ve worked tirelessly over the years to make a living and provide for your loved ones. As you look forward to your financial future and in your golden years, it has never been more important to protect your hard earned money. Join experts from AARP, D.C. Office of Attorney General, D.C. Department of Insurance, Securities and Banking, the Financial Industry Regulatory Authority, the Securities and Exchange Commission for a free, virtual, interactive discussion on how you can continue to manage your financial future and keeping your money safe from scams and fraud.
